    Otavio

    The first and third images are not, in my view, strong images from a compositional point of view. They are well executed; i.e. teh exposure and the use of light is very good. But I'm thinking - 'Yes, but what is it I'm being invited to look at?'

    On the other hand, I think the second one is a very strong image. It is well balanced. The horizon is well placed. The land in the foreground provides a good strong line that sweeps our eye in from the left of the frame and across to the right hand side. I think it is a very well constructed image.
